Generally, liquids that are in line with a cat’s carnivorous … WebAdding flavor to your cat’s water can make it more appealing to them. You can add a small amount of tuna water or chicken broth to their water. You can also buy flavored water additives specifically designed for cats. Be careful not to add too much flavoring, as it can cause diarrhea. You can even use tuna juice, or frozen tuna juice ice ...

WebJan 24, 2024 · Cats shouldn’t drink flavored water, even if that’s the only type of water you can get your cat to drink. The reason is that flavored waters often contain artificial flavors and sugar, but even water that contains natural flavors still contains sugar.
